2009-09-03 12:48:38 | JeffR writes:

This car was purchased by myself at the above mentioned auction and has formed part of my collection of classic cars since then. It has light summer use on outings and club events.
In August 2006 I drove the car (without problem) to Switzerland nr. Zurich where I currently live . It now runs under a Swiss registration. Still in condition 1 the car has been upgraded to include stainless exhaust, GAZ shocks, 123 ignition and P4000 tyres.

2013-10-14 10:55:11 | JeffR writes:

This car was repatriated back to Camberley , UK at the beginning of October 2012.and was re registered under its original UK registration number UVP 592H.

Car remains in Class 1 condition throughout with additional improvements being>

new seat foams, battery, halogen headlights, refurbished and uprated radiator.
